Title of article :
Construction of a heteropolyanion-modified electrode by a two-step sol–gel method and its electrocatalytic applications

Abstract :
The sol–gel technique was used here to construct heteropolyanion-containing modified electrodes. This involves two steps, i.e. the first forming a functionalized sol–gel thin film on the surface of the glassy carbon electrode and then immersing the electrode into a heteropolyanion solution to incorporate the heteropolyanion into the sol–gel film. Here a Dawson-type heteropolyanion, K6P2W18O62 (P2W18), was used as a representative to illuminate the behavior of the as-prepared composite film. The electrochemical performance of the P2W18-modified electrode was studied with respect to the pH effect and long-term stability. The modified electrode exhibited a high electrocatalytic response for the reduction of BrO3− and NO2−. Steady-state amperometry was applied to characterize the electrode as an amperometric sensor for the determination of NO2−. The sensor had a linear range from 0.02 to 34 mM and a detection limit of 5×10−6 M.
